CALL FOR VOLUNTEERS

Volunteers needed for screening of Delirious Machines at Sound Scape Park in Miami Beach,
November 20, 2016 7PM-11PM

Description: Volunteers will be asked to assist with set up/break down of materials and promotion of our events and exhibitions. Volunteers will assist in setting up temporary trash receptacles, directing audience members to said trash receptacles as well as the public restrooms. Volunteers will need to commit to staying through the end of the screening, at which time they will assist in helping to clean up and dispose of any trash left behind by the audience.

What this involves: Light labor, ability to walk, sit and bend down and collect trash left by attendees. A positive disposition and ability to communicate with people.

The hours: 7PM-11PM as needed.

The perks: Free ArtCenter/South Florida T-shirt.

Mission Statement

The mission of Oolite Arts is to support artists and advance the knowledge and practice of contemporary visual arts and culture in South Florida. Oolite Arts creates opportunities for experimentation and innovation and encourages the exchange of ideas across cultures through residencies, exhibitions, public programs, education and outreach.
